In recent days, "Happy Spring Festival" celebrations have unfolded worldwide, with vibrant cultural events sharing the festive spirit of the Spring Festival and introducing elements of Chinese culture to the global audience.
In Serbia, a Chinese New Year reception for overseas Chinese and "Happy Spring Festival" gala was held at the Chinese Cultural Center in Belgrade. Chinese Ambassador to Serbia Li Ming attended and delivered remarks.
Artists from China and Serbia collaborated at the event to deliver a vibrant cultural presentation that fused cultural traditions of the two countries.
"Horse represents power, speed, and all the things that are related to success. So in this manner, I believe also here in Serbia we will have a good success with our Chinese friends," said Dragoljub Bajic, director of the National Theater in Belgrade.
"I wish you a lot of strength, a lot of patience, and typical Chinese wisdom to win in this special year. In Serbian culture, we like horses. Horses for us means strength, speed, and vision. So the same I wish for your people," said Vice President of the Serbia National Assembly Marina Ragus, who also attended the event.
Meanwhile, the 2026 "Happy Spring Festival" performance and "Hello! China" tourism promotion event was staged in Prague, the Czech Republic. The program combined the refined elegance of traditional Chinese arts with modern stage aesthetics, drawing warm responses from the audience.
"In the Year of Fire Horse, let me wish all the best, peace, and prosperity to the people of China," said Ondrej Dostal, a European Parliament member from the Czech Republic.
